fix(routing): only route to originating channel when cross-provider

When OriginatingChannel matches Surface (same provider), use normal
dispatcher. Only route via routeReply() when they differ, ensuring
cross-provider messages (e.g., Telegram queued while Slack active)
get routed back to their origin.

// Check if we should route replies to originating channel instead of dispatcher.
// Only route when the originating channel is DIFFERENT from the current surface.
// This handles cross-provider routing (e.g., message from Telegram being processed
// by a shared session that's currently on Slack) while preserving normal dispatcher
// flow when the provider handles its own messages.
const originatingChannel = ctx.OriginatingChannel;
const originatingTo = ctx.OriginatingTo;
const currentSurface = ctx.Surface?.toLowerCase();
const shouldRouteToOriginating =
isRoutableChannel(originatingChannel) &&
originatingTo &&
originatingChannel !== currentSurface;
